#CB882B Hex Color Code

#CB882B

The Hexadecimal Color #CB882B is a contrast shade of Peru. #CB882B RGB value is rgb(203, 136, 43). RGB Color Model of #CB882B consists of 79% red, 53% green and 16% blue. HSL color Mode of #CB882B has 35°(degrees) Hue, 65% Saturation and 48% Lightness. #CB882B color has an wavelength of 597.96296n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CB882B is #CC9933.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CB882B is #C83. The Closest Color to #CB882B is #CD853F. Official Name of #CB882B Hex Code is Brandy Punch.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CB882B is 0 Cyan 33 Magenta 79 Yellow 20 Black and #CB882B CMY is 0, 33, 79.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#CB882B is hsl(35,65,48,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(35, 79, 80).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#CB882B is 33.87, 30.48, 6.38.
Hex8 Value of #CB882B is #CB882BFF. Decimal Value of #CB882B is 13338667 and Octal Value of #CB882B is 62704053. Binary Value of #CB882B is 11001011, 10001000, 101011 and Android of #CB882B is 4291528747 / 0xffcb882b.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#CB882B is 0.479, 0.431, 0.431 and YIQ Color Space of #CB882B is 145.431, 69.8062, -14.7711.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#CB882B is 36.88, 27.95, 6.79.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#CB882B is 62.07, 17.99, 56.92.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#CB882B is 62.07, 54.62, 55.92.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#CB882B is 62.07, 59.7, 72.46. Hunter Lab variable of #CB882B is 55.21, 12.89, 31.79.

Various Color Shades of #CB882B

To get 25% Saturated #CB882B Color, you need to convert the hex color #CB882B to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#CB882B h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CB882B

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
